Is there any opportunity to Ballroom/Latin Dance on Constellation?

Have you checked the app to see if there's anything scheduled?  I haven't been on the Constellation but on our recent Summit cruise there was an hour or so of ballroom dancing every day (or almost every day) in the Rendevous lounge.  It was pre-recorded music (I didn't attend but I saw it in the daily).  This was a repo cruise so there were a lot of sea days.  I don't know if that's the norm.

Just off the TA Constellation from April 17 to May 2.  There were many opportunities to dance. The two bands were very good at "reading the passengers' pulse" and played music that got them to get up and dance. Very little Latin music except at the pool area.
